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
AIC I.doc
Скачиваний:
15
Добавлен:
23.11.2019
Размер:
840.19 Кб
Скачать

6 Классификация програмного обеспечения (по) средств измерений

Проведение метрологической аттестации программного обеспечения (ПО) средств измерений (СИ) требует четкого установления требований к ПО и методов его испытаний. К различным видам ПО СИ предъявляются разные требования и, соответственно, методики испытаний, которые зависят от характера и уровня таких требований.

Например, Руководство WЕLМЕС 7.1 определяет следующие требования к ПО СИ:

• жесткость испытаний;

• степень соответствия;

• уровень защиты.

При этом указываются уровни требований для указанных характеристик: низкая, средняя, высокая.

Степень соответствия программного обеспечения (идентификация): низкая, средняя, высокая.

Защита программного обеспечения: низкая, средняя, высокая.

Стандарт ГОСТ Р ИСО/МЭК ТО 12182-2002 “Классификация программных средств” описывает структуру видов и приводит схему классификации программных средств.

В стандарте приводится следующая структура видов ПО:

Внутренние виды.

Виды среды.

Виды данных.

Основным классификационным признаком в рамках рекомендации МОЗМ R 76 является аппаратная конфигурация.

Руководство МID-Softwаrе первичным классификационным признаком считает разделение на основе аппаратной конфигурации – встроенное ПО (СИ) и автономное ПО (ПК).

Встроенное ПОПО автономного СИ, которое в общем случае представляет собой целевое устройство с установленным набором измерительных функций. Автономное ПОПО в общем случае функционирующее на базе ПК.

Классы автономного ПО:

Класс 1ПО, работающее на базе ПК в связанное с определенным типом СИ.

Класс 2ПО, работающее на базе ПК и не связанное с СИ.

Функция ПО: классификация по функциональному признаку ПО показывает, не ограничены ли функции ПО одним из указанных классификационных признаков.

Готовность ПО: классификация ПО в рамках данного вида позволяет указать возможности ПО к изменению (модификации или расширению) его функций.

Коммерческое (готовое) ПО – в общем случае это ПО, которое поставляется вместе с СИ и не может быть изменено пользователем средствами самого ПО.

Модифицируемое коммерческое ПОПО, чьи функции могут быть расширены или модифицированы в ограниченной степени для специальных приложений средствами самого ПО.

Целевое ПОПО, разработанное пользователем или субподрядчиком, программа которого написана, например, на одном из языков программирования.

Вид “Готовность ПО” обозначен в стандарте ИСО/МЭК 17025 и требуется для определения жесткости испытаний.

Критичность ПО обозначает уровень последствий в случае искажения измерительных данных, неправильного использования ошибок ПО. Устанавливается 3 уровня критичности: низкий, средний, высокий.

В соответствии с WЕLМЕС 7.1, Рекомендацией МИ 2891-2004Общие требования к программному обеспечению средств измерений” при аттестации ПО необходимо назначить уровни для жесткости испытаний, степень защиты и уровень соответствия.

Приведенная классификация не является исчерпывающей и не решает автоматически задачу назначения уровней требований.

7 Классификация и характеристики по для сбора и обработки измерительной информации

7.1 Сетевые суперсреды

Данные программные продукты представляют собой интегрированные сетевые программные среды для измерения параметров, контроля распределенных промышленных объектов, систем и технологических процессов и управления ими; имеют расширенную сетевую клиент - серверную архитектуру, что позволяет проводить мониторинг распределенных систем сбора данных и управления с нескольких удаленных операторных станций, размещенных по сети. Среди них можно выделить:

- универсальные, работающие на достаточно произвольных сетевых конфигурациях;

- специализированные, предназначенные для использования на сетевых конфигурациях и с аппаратным обеспечением конкретного производителя.

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]